The Uniform Mitigation Verification Inspection Form (OIR-B1-1802) is Florida's standardized report documenting a home's wind-resistant features — roof covering, deck attachment, roof-to-wall connections, roof geometry, secondary water resistance, and opening protection. Florida homeowners use it to qualify for the hurricane-mitigation discounts insurers are required by law to offer, which can take a significant share off the windstorm portion of a premium. It's completed by an authorized Florida inspector — a licensed home or building inspector, a general/building/residential contractor, a professional engineer, or an architect — and is valid for up to five years.
